Alignment control in gravitational-wave detectors has consistently proven to be a

dicult problem due to the stringent noise contamination requirement for the gravitational

wave readout and the radiation-pressure induced angular instability in Fabry-

Perot cavities (Sidles-Sigg instability). In this thesis, I present optical springs as a

tool to damp the motion of a mirror. I discuss the design and implementation of a single

degree-of-freedom optical spring system and the importance of the photothermal

eect in properly predicting optical spring behavior.
